Abstract:
Digital models and intra-oral scanners are gaining increasing popularity in orthodontic diagnosis and treatment planning by allowing clinicians to store and 'virtually' analyse dental casts. The present paper reviews the various digital model programs and available intra-oral scanners and presents the research which has tested their accuracy. With this information, clinicians may be better informed to adopt the most appropriate system.
